Adding music to your movie is a great way to enhance the overall experience and evoke emotions in your audience. If you’re using Movie Maker to edit your videos, here’s a step-by-step guide on how to add music to your project and make it even more captivating!

Step 1: Open Movie Maker and Import Your Media

The first thing you need to do is open Movie Maker and import the video clips and images you want to use in your project. To do this:

  1. Click on the “Home” tab in the top menu.
  2. Click on the “Add videos and photos” button.
  3. Select the files you want to import and click “Open”.

Step 2: Import Your Music

Now it’s time to import the music you want to add to your movie. Follow these simple steps:

  1. Click on the “Home” tab.
  2. Click on the “Add music” button.
  3. Navigate to the location of the music file on your computer and click “Open”.

Step 3: Arrange and Trim Your Music

Once the music is imported, you can arrange it and trim it to fit perfectly with your video:

  1. Click on the “Project” tab.
  2. Drag the imported music file to the “Music” track on the timeline.
  3. Drag the edges of the music clip to adjust its duration to your liking.

Step 4: Adjust the Music Volume

Having control over the volume of your music is crucial to ensure a balanced audio mix. To adjust the volume:

  1. Click on the “Edit” tab.
  2. Click on the “Music Tools” tab.
  3. Under the “Audio Levels” section, adjust the “Music” slider as per your preference.

Step 5: Apply Fade In/Fade Out Effects

Fade in and fade out effects can give your movie a professional touch. Here’s how to apply them:

  1. Select the music clip on the timeline.
  2. Click on the “Edit” tab.
  3. Click on the “Music Tools” tab.
  4. Under the “Audio Options” section, choose either “Fade In” or “Fade Out” to apply the effect.

Step 6: Preview and Save Your Movie

Before finalizing your movie, it’s important to preview it and make sure everything is in place. To do so:

  1. Click on the “Play” button in the preview pane.
  2. If you’re satisfied with the result, click on the “File” tab.
  3. Choose “Save movie” to save your project in the desired format.
